RS-7
Single-Family Residential Zone
The RS zone is applied to areas of the City appropriate for single-family residential land uses in neighborhoods at a density of three to six units per net acre, subject to appropriate standards. The specific allowable density for each parcel is shown on the Zoning Map by a numerical suffix residential density designator (see Section D2-8). Minimum lot size for new parcels ranges from 3,500 to 12,000 sq ft. Depending upon the applicable residential density designator, the RS zone is consistent with and implements the Single Family Low Density, Single Family Low-Medium Density, and Single Family Medium Density land use classifications of the General Plan.
